pcrum Posted December 19, 2010 #29 Share Posted December 19, 2010 A notepad is essential for me since Carnival does not give you the free memo pad in the room anymore (although they do give you a free pen). The notepad is to leave notes in the room for family to let them know where we are and is also helpful if we need to leave the room steward a note. I don't want to overlook something. Since your luggage may not appear at your cabin door for a few hours after embarkation, pack your swimsuit and pool items (sunscreen, etc.) in your carry-on. Then you can enjoy the pool until your cabin is ready and luggage arrives. Embarkation day is typically the least crowded day for the pools--a great time to enjoy them.
